Ordinals
beta
Address bc1q95jtfxrtszk6qxjyw8rrgedh706f20fau79ve8
sat balance
104311
runes balances
outputs
d94bb89ff99ebfd4fee8346b4efa40630ce1326d0a20989f7906c8bca4eca57b:17